Security

There are a myriad of security features that can be added to UPVC doors to help protect your home. These security features are effective cheap, cost-effective, and simple to implement. They do not provide 100% security.

Burglars will always seek ways to gain access. The most frequent method is to snap the replace lock in upvc door. You stand a better chance of preventing this kind of break-in if you have an anti snap lock.

Another option is to break into by using the help of a heavy object. This is extremely difficult to prevent. You'll be unable to safeguard your home from this risk unless you have a monitored alarm system.

A good first step to safeguard your patio door is to ensure that it has security bars. These can be put in place prior to you go to sleep and before you go to work. In the evening doors are particularly vulnerable.

Another crucial step to take is to make use of hinge bolts. A hinge bolt is a great idea, especially if the door has an opening to the outside.

Door chains are also useful for securing upvc panel door doors. They are not strong enough to withstand all force kicks or ramming attacks.

If your door is equipped with glass panels that is glass, you can add a shatterproof layer. Different kinds of shatterproof films are offered, and you can choose the one that is best suitable for your requirements. Some are transparent, while others are tinted.

Security cameras can be used to detect burglars in action. You can also install a motion-activated light which does not require hard wiring. You can also install security lighting to scare away intruders.

While no security measure is 100% foolproof but you can significantly reduce the risk by taking the right steps to secure your home.
